congeal

verb
/kənˈdʒiːl/

Meaning

to become thick or solid, especially from cooling

Example Sentences

The soup began to congeal after being left on the table.

Synonyms

solidify, clot, thicken, harden

Antonyms

melt, liquefy

Collocations

congeal into, congeal blood, congeal quickly
